Wedding Jewellery & UK Traditions

Wedding jewellery and uk traditionaSomething old, something new, something borrowed, something blue is the tradition for brides on their big day.

Even a contemporary modern bride can still embrace the joy of wedding traditions as part of the fun of the ceremony.

Something old, is a great way of involving family history. For my own wedding I had my great grandmother’s engagement ring sewn on to my petticoat. If you can’t get something old you could purchase vintage wedding jewellery which has been restored and revived.

Something new will be more than likely your wedding dress, unless you plan to borrow a dress from a relative to wear as they walk down the aisle. Embrace something new with items of Wedding Jewellery or a tiara or hair accessory that can be bought to accessorise perfectly with your dress. You shoes are also a great something new.

Something Borrowed.... friends and family will love to lend you things to wear on your wedding day. An underskirt or petticoat, veil, tiara, garter, necklace, bracelet or brooch, if you really like you can talk to Jenni and see if bespoken for can hire some jewellery for your wedding.

Something Blue... we will put a free blue bead in any jewellery design you like as a little something blue. Other ideas are for a friend to sew a blue ribbon into your dress, blue garter or perhaps embroider a handkerchief with your new initials.
